Skip to main content
ONTAP MetroCluster
简体中文版经机器翻译而成,仅供参考。如与英语版出现任何冲突,应以英语版为准。

刷新四节点或八节点MetroCluster IP配置(ONTAP 9.8及更高版本)

贡献者

您可以使用此操作步骤 升级四节点或八节点配置中的控制器和存储。

从ONTAP 9.13.1开始、您可以通过将八节点MetroCluster IP配置扩展为临时十二节点配置、然后删除旧的灾难恢复(DR)组来升级该配置中的控制器和存储。

从ONTAP 9.8开始、您可以通过将四节点MetroCluster IP配置扩展为临时八节点配置并删除旧DR组来升级此配置中的控制器和存储。

关于此任务
  • 如果您使用的是八节点配置、则系统必须运行ONTAP 9.13.1或更高版本。

  • 如果您使用的是四节点配置、则系统必须运行ONTAP 9.8或更高版本。

  • 如果您还在升级IP交换机、则必须先升级这些交换机、然后再执行此刷新操作步骤。

  • 本操作步骤 介绍了刷新一个四节点DR组所需的步骤。如果您使用的是八节点配置(两个DR组)、则可以刷新一个或两个DR组。

    如果同时刷新两个DR组、则必须一次刷新一个DR组。

  • 引用 " 旧节点 " 是指要替换的节点。

  • 对于八节点配置、必须支持源和目标八节点MetroCluster 平台组合。

    备注 如果同时刷新两个DR组、则在刷新第一个DR组后可能不支持此平台组合。您必须刷新这两个DR组、才能实现受支持的八节点配置。
  • 在MetroCluster IP配置中、只能使用此操作步骤 刷新特定平台型号。

  • 源平台和目标平台的下限适用。如果要过渡到更高平台、则只有在所有灾难恢复组的技术更新完成后、新平台的限制才适用。

  • 如果您对限制低于源平台的平台执行技术更新、则必须在执行此操作步骤 之前将限制调整为或低于目标平台限制。

步骤
  1. 验证是否已在旧节点上创建默认广播域。

    向不具有默认广播域的现有集群添加新节点时、系统会使用通用唯一标识符(UID)(而不是预期名称)为新节点创建节点管理生命周期。有关详细信息、请参见知识库文章 "使用UUID名称生成的新添加节点上的节点管理生命周期"

  2. 从旧节点收集信息。

    在此阶段,四节点配置如下图所示:

    MCC DR 组 A

    此时将显示八节点配置、如下图所示:

    MCC DR 组 8 个节点
  3. 要防止自动生成支持案例,请发送一条 AutoSupport 消息以指示升级正在进行中。

    1. 问题描述以下命令: + ssystem node AutoSupport invoke -node * -type all -message "MAIN=10h upgrading old-model to new-model"

      以下示例指定了一个 10 小时的维护时段。根据您的计划,您可能需要留出更多时间。

      如果在该时间过后完成维护,您可以调用一条 AutoSupport 消息,指示维护期结束:

    ssystem node AutoSupport invoke -node * -type all -message MAINT=end

    1. 在配对集群上重复此命令。

  4. 从 Tiebreaker ,调解器或其他可启动切换的软件中删除现有 MetroCluster 配置。

    如果您使用的是 …​

    使用此操作步骤 …​

    Tiebreaker

    1. 使用 Tiebreaker CLI monitor remove 命令删除 MetroCluster 配置。

      在以下示例中,从软件中删除了 "`cluster_A` " :

      NetApp MetroCluster Tiebreaker :> monitor remove -monitor-name cluster_A
      Successfully removed monitor from NetApp MetroCluster Tiebreaker
      software.
    2. 使用Tieb破碎 机命令行界面确认已正确删除MetroCluster 配置 monitor show -status 命令:

      NetApp MetroCluster Tiebreaker :> monitor show -status

    调解器

    在 ONTAP 提示符处问题描述以下命令:

    MetroCluster configuration-settings mediator remove

    第三方应用程序

    请参见产品文档。

  5. 执行中的所有步骤 "扩展MetroCluster IP配置" 将新节点和存储添加到配置中。

    扩展操作步骤 完成后、将显示临时配置、如以下图像所示:

    MCC DR 组 b
    图 1. 临时八节点配置
    MCC DR组C4
    图 2. 临时十二节点配置
  6. 在两个集群上运行以下命令、以确认可以接管并且节点已连接:

    s存储故障转移显示

    cluster_A::> storage failover show
                                        Takeover
    Node           Partner              Possible    State Description
    -------------- -------------------- ---------   ------------------
    Node_FC_1      Node_FC_2              true      Connected to Node_FC_2
    Node_FC_2      Node_FC_1              true      Connected to Node_FC_1
    Node_IP_1      Node_IP_2              true      Connected to Node_IP_2
    Node_IP_2      Node_IP_1              true      Connected to Node_IP_1
  7. 移动 CRS 卷。

  8. 使用中的以下过程将数据从旧节点移动到新节点 "ONTAP硬件系统文档"

    1. 执行中的所有步骤 "创建聚合并将卷移动到新节点"

      备注 您可以选择在创建聚合时或之后对其进行镜像。
    2. 执行中的所有步骤 "将非 SAN 数据 LIF 和集群管理 LIF 移动到新节点"

  9. 修改每个集群中已转移节点的集群对等方的IP地址:

    1. 使用确定cluster-A对等方 cluster peer show 命令:

      cluster_A::> cluster peer show
      Peer Cluster Name         Cluster Serial Number Availability   Authentication
      ------------------------- --------------------- -------------- --------------
      cluster_B         1-80-000011           Unavailable    absent
      1. 修改cluster A对等IP地址:

        cluster peer modify -cluster cluster_A -peer-addrs node_A_3_IP -address-family ipv4

    2. 使用确定cluster-B对等方 cluster peer show 命令:

      cluster_B::> cluster peer show
      Peer Cluster Name         Cluster Serial Number Availability   Authentication
      ------------------------- --------------------- -------------- --------------
      cluster_A         1-80-000011           Unavailable    absent
      1. 修改cluster B对等IP地址:

        cluster peer modify -cluster cluster_B -peer-addrs node_B_3_IP -address-family ipv4

    3. 验证是否已更新每个集群的集群对等IP地址:

      1. 使用验证是否已更新每个集群的IP地址 cluster peer show -instance 命令:

        Remote Intercluster Addresses 字段显示更新后的IP地址。

        cluster A的示例:

      cluster_A::> cluster peer show -instance
      
      Peer Cluster Name: cluster_B
                 Remote Intercluster Addresses: 172.21.178.204, 172.21.178.212
            Availability of the Remote Cluster: Available
                           Remote Cluster Name: cluster_B
                           Active IP Addresses: 172.21.178.212, 172.21.178.204
                         Cluster Serial Number: 1-80-000011
                          Remote Cluster Nodes: node_B_3-IP,
                                                node_B_4-IP
                         Remote Cluster Health: true
                       Unreachable Local Nodes: -
                Address Family of Relationship: ipv4
          Authentication Status Administrative: use-authentication
             Authentication Status Operational: ok
                              Last Update Time: 4/20/2023 18:23:53
                  IPspace for the Relationship: Default
      Proposed Setting for Encryption of Inter-Cluster Communication: -
      Encryption Protocol For Inter-Cluster Communication: tls-psk
        Algorithm By Which the PSK Was Derived: jpake
      
      cluster_A::>

      + cluster B的示例

    cluster_B::> cluster peer show -instance
    
                           Peer Cluster Name: cluster_A
               Remote Intercluster Addresses: 172.21.178.188, 172.21.178.196 <<<<<<<< Should reflect the modified address
          Availability of the Remote Cluster: Available
                         Remote Cluster Name: cluster_A
                         Active IP Addresses: 172.21.178.196, 172.21.178.188
                       Cluster Serial Number: 1-80-000011
                        Remote Cluster Nodes: node_A_3-IP,
                                              node_A_4-IP
                       Remote Cluster Health: true
                     Unreachable Local Nodes: -
              Address Family of Relationship: ipv4
        Authentication Status Administrative: use-authentication
           Authentication Status Operational: ok
                            Last Update Time: 4/20/2023 18:23:53
                IPspace for the Relationship: Default
    Proposed Setting for Encryption of Inter-Cluster Communication: -
    Encryption Protocol For Inter-Cluster Communication: tls-psk
      Algorithm By Which the PSK Was Derived: jpake
    
    cluster_B::>
  10. 按照中的步骤进行操作 "删除灾难恢复组" 以删除旧DR组。

  11. 如果要刷新八节点配置中的两个DR组、则必须对每个DR组重复整个操作步骤。

    删除旧DR组后、配置将如以下图像所示:

    MCC DR 组 d
    图 3. 四节点配置
    MCC DR组C5
    图 4. 八节点配置
  12. 确认 MetroCluster 配置的运行模式并执行 MetroCluster 检查。

    1. 确认 MetroCluster 配置以及操作模式是否正常:

      MetroCluster show

    2. 确认显示所有预期节点:

      MetroCluster node show

    3. 问题描述以下命令:

      MetroCluster check run

    4. 显示 MetroCluster 检查的结果:

      MetroCluster check show`

  13. 根据需要使用适用于您的配置的操作步骤还原监控。

    如果您使用的是 …​

    使用此操作步骤

    Tiebreaker

    "正在添加 MetroCluster 配置" 在 _MetroCluster Tiebreaker 安装和配置 _ 中。

    调解器

    "从 MetroCluster IP 配置配置 ONTAP 调解器服务" 在 _IP MetroCluster 安装和配置 _ 中。

    第三方应用程序

    请参见产品文档。

  14. 要恢复自动生成支持案例,请发送 AutoSupport 消息以指示维护已完成。

    1. 问题描述以下命令:

      ssystem node AutoSupport invoke -node * -type all -message MAINT=end

    2. 在配对集群上重复此命令。